Laufwerksexistens prüfen

überprüft die Existens eines Laufwerks



'überprüfung, ob Laufwerk "E" existiert
 
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As
System.EventArgs) Handles MyBase.Load
 
If DriveExists("E:") = True Then
 
MsgBox("E: existiert")
 
Else
 
MsgBox("E: existiert nicht")
 
End If
 
End Sub
 
 
 
'Funktion zur überprüfung des ausgewählten Laufwerks
 
Public Function DriveExists( _
 
ByVal sDriveLetter As String) As Boolean
 
Dim sLogicalDrive As String
 
Dim sLogicalDrives As String()
 
sDriveLetter = vb.Left(sDriveLetter, 1) & ":"
 
sLogicalDrives = System.IO.Directory.GetLogicalDrives()
 
For Each sLogicalDrive In sLogicalDrives
 
If sLogicalDrive = sDriveLetter Then
 
Return True
 
End If
 
Next
 
End Function